Excel 计算在一定列数中有值的行数

Excel 计算在一定列数中有值的行数

我在 Excel 中有一个工作表,有 30 行和近 80 列。每个单元格可以有一个正数或“-”。我想计算少于 10 列中有正数的行数(没有数据透视表或其他绕过的解决方案,只有一个单元格中的公式)。

答案1

如果您确实允许单个辅助列(您可以隐藏它),请将此公式放入第一行最后一个数据单元格右侧的单元格中,其中X需要用包含数据的最后一列替换:

=IF(COUNTIF(A1:x1,"<>-")<10,1,0)

然后将此单元格复制到此单元格下方的所有单元格(所有行)中。

然后计算这些列的总和。瞧。

相关内容